Tributes for former Vice-Chancellor of UWC Prof Brian O’Connell

Tuesday, August 27, 2024

Science, Technology and Innovation Minister, Professor Blade Nzimande, has expressed great shock and sadness at the passing of the former Vice-Chancellor of the University of the Western Cape (UWC), Professor Brian O’Connell.

O’Connell passed away on Sunday at the age of 77.

The Minister has remembered O’Connell as an “illustrious” educationist and higher education leader who played a seminal role in basic and higher education following the advent of democracy in South Africa.
